About

Philip‐John Lamey is a scholar working on Periodontics, Physiology and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, Philip‐John Lamey has authored 31 papers receiving a total of 934 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Periodontics, 7 papers in Physiology and 6 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in Philip‐John Lamey’s work include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(6 papers), Oral Health Pathology and Treatment (5 papers) and Peptidase Inhibition and Analysis (5 papers). Philip‐John Lamey is often cited by papers focused on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(6 papers), Oral Health Pathology and Treatment (5 papers) and Peptidase Inhibition and Analysis (5 papers). Philip‐John Lamey coll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Jordan and United States. Philip‐John Lamey's co-authors include Fionnuala T. Lundy, Gerard J. Linden, Mahmoud K. AL‐Omiri, Thomas Clifford, P.A. Biagioni, I C Benington, Edward Lynch, Ruth Freeman, Caroline L. Pankhurst and Terry D. Rees and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Pathology, Journal Of Clinical Periodontology and Clinical Oral Implants Research.
